Sandy Ochoa is a native of Tucson with 5 generations and grew up in a barrio her entire life. She retired from Pima County in 2011 with degrees in Nursing and Nutritional Education for women, infants and children. She has been involved in the labor movement her whole life as she comes from a family of unions. She has also worked for SEIU and AFSCME as a representative. She was also given the Dolores Huerta La Mujer En La Lucha Award in 2021.
